Output 73140a28e307c666d196ef91ff9e6db451ec1d75e9f45e8c61ee5ab216ae729d:4

value
164014325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b74695b7c535970702bf7ab82009e4cd0d37bdf OP_EQUAL
address
3P9zB3HzKX2cVRMxeNmi4mFRL6jdYNpXt9
transaction
73140a28e307c666d196ef91ff9e6db451ec1d75e9f45e8c61ee5ab216ae729d
confirmations
346867
spent
true